Abo Moati net profit down 56% to SAR 4.5 mln in 9M FY2020/21

Abdullah Saad Mohammed Abo Moati for Bookstores Co. (Abo Moati) reported a net profit after Zakat and tax of SAR 4.5 million for the nine months period ended Dec. 31, 2020, 56% year-on-year (YoY) decline, from compared to SAR 10.1 million in the same period last year.

 

The fall in net profit was attributed to 25.6% decline in sales due to the decisions issued by the competent authorities within the precautionary measures and decisions to convert the study pattern to distance education to mitigate the spread of the COVID-19. In addition, the company paid customs differences pertaining to previous years amounting to SAR 2.5 million.



Financials (M)

Item 9m 2019 9m 2020 Change‬
Revenues 221.55 164.81 (25.6 %)
Gross Income 44.25 34.19 (22.7 %)
Operating Income 14.98 7.42 (50.5 %)
Net Income 10.12 4.50 (55.6 %)
Average Shares 20.00 20.00 -
EPS (Riyals) 0.51 0.22 (55.6 %)


Current Quarter Comparison (M)

Compared With The
Item Q3 2019 Q3 2020 Change‬
Revenues 84.59 68.39 (19.2 %)
Gross Income 17.29 13.89 (19.6 %)
Operating Income 5.86 4.21 (28.2 %)
Net Income 4.78 3.00 (37.3 %)
Average Shares 20.00 20.00 -
EPS (Riyals) 0.24 0.15 (37.3 %)

The company reported a net profit of SAR 3 million in Q3 ending Dec. 31, 2020, a 37% YoY decline, from SAR 4.8 million in the same quarter last year on lower sales.

 

When compared to previous quarter, net profit almost quadrupled due to higher sales as a result of returning to normal activities after the curfew period during the first quarter.
